CVE-2024-6076 is a Reflected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ability affecting the wp-cart-for-digital-products WordPress plugin versions prior to 8.5.5, specifically impacting tipsandtricks_hq wp_estore. This medium-severity vulnerability (CVSS 6.1) allows an attacker to inject malicious scripts due to improper sanitization of a parameter, potentially compromising high-privilege user accounts like administrators. There is currently no public exploit code available (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), nor is it listed on the CISA KEV catalog, indicating no active exploitation.
